I am currently working on a custom module for Odoo 17 and facing an issue with JavaScript customization in the Point of Sale (POS) module. I am trying to override the add_product method in the POS, but my changes don't seem to take effect. I've ensured that my JavaScript file is included in the point_of_sale.assets bundle, but I'm not seeing the expected behavior or any console logs that I've added for debugging.


I included the JavaScript file in the point_of_sale.assets bundle in my module's __manifest__.py. Here's a snippet of the code for reference:


odoo.define('give_and_get_order_module.CustomOrder', function(require) {
    'use strict';

    var models = require('point_of_sale.models');
    var OrderSuper = models.Order.prototype;

    models.Order.include({
        add_product: function(product, options) {
            console.log("Custom add_product method called");
            if (!options || !options.quantity) {
                options = options || {};
                options.quantity = -1;
            }
            return OrderSuper.add_product.apply(this, [product, options]);
        },
    });
});

And the relevant part of my __manifest__.py:

'assets': {
    'point_of_sale.assets': [
        'give_and_get_order_module/static/src/js/custom_order.js',
    ],
},

I would appreciate any insights or suggestions on what I might be missing or doing wrong. Is there a specific aspect of POS module customization in Odoo 17 that I need to be aware of?

For inheriting add_product function, we need to follow the steps defined below:

1. Create models.js file under static > src > overrides > models directory.

2. Use the below code for inheriting Order from base models.js using Patch.


/* @odoo-module /


import { Order, Orderline, Payment } from "@point_of_sale/app/store/models";

import { patch } from "@web/core/utils/patch";


patch(Order.prototype, {

    async add_product(product, options) {

// Your custom code

        return super.add_product(...arguments);

    },

});


3. Insert custom JS path in manifest.

Note:- Add ‘point_of_sale’ in your customer module’s depends.

- Odoo.define is deprecated in Odoo V17.

From your code, it seems like you’re correctly including your JavaScript file in the 'point_of_sale.assets' bundle and your method override also looks correct. However, there are a few things you might want to check:

  1. Order of JS files: Ensure that your JavaScript file is loaded after the original file you’re trying to override. The order of JavaScript files in the assets bundle can affect the behavior of your customization.
  2. Module Dependency: Make sure that your custom module depends on the 'point_of_sale' module. You can specify this in the 'depends' section of your '__manifest__.py' file.
  3. Browser Cache: Clear your browser cache or try in incognito mode. Sometimes, the browser might be loading a cached version of your JavaScript file.
  4. Server Restart: After making changes to the '__manifest__.py' file, you need to restart your Odoo server and upgrade your module.

If you’ve checked all of these and your method override is still not working, it might be due to some changes in Odoo 17’s POS module. In Odoo 17, there are new ways to load custom models and fields. You might need to inherit the 'pos.session' model and overwrite the '_pos_ui_models_to_load()' method. Also, creating a custom screen involves patching the 'PosStore' and overriding the '_processData' function.
